Well, here we go again.........since fixing the intake leak issue a couple of weeks back, there has been no coolant loss..........this is a good thing !!
Now the oil decides it needs a little of my time.....for the first 3-5 seconds after starting the car everything is fine, then the check oil level light comes on and stays on for about 10-20 seconds then goes off. The oil level is fine so I ASSUME it is a sensor reading from somewhere. Any ideas which one and where????? Thanks.......

Yes there is an oil level check sensor in the oil pan similar to a brake fluid or washer fluid sensor.
If it only does it right when you start up the car it might be going through a self check with the computer. Strange that it would start doing it so randomly though. Go look around and make sure you did not knock any wires lose when you fixed the intake leak there might be a bad connection some where.
